Conferences are a meaningful opportunity to connect with your child’s teacher, ask questions, and gain a deeper understanding of your child’s experience at school. Teachers will share work samples that highlight growth and point toward next steps - both academically and with social/emotional development. You will also receive a conference summary outlining areas of strength, goals for continued growth, and suggestions for supporting learning at home.
